Embark on a flavorful journey through the ancient streets of Dubrovnik, guided by a local expert who will share the stories behind each dish and the history of this stunning city. In cozy, intimate settings, you’ll indulge in some of the most beloved traditional flavors of Dubrovnik. Here's a taste of what you'll experience: Begin with Mediterranean tapas, inspired by the city’s Ragusan heritage. These small plates combine different ingredients, offering a snapshot of Dubrovnik’s coastal flavors. Next, dive into a wine tasting where you’ll sample local varieties, each reflecting the sun-soaked terroir of the Dalmatian coast. For a true taste of the sea, savor Crni Rižot, a deep, rich black risotto made with cuttlefish or squid ink, garlic, and olive oil, capturing the essence of the Adriatic. Then, enjoy burek, the flaky, golden pastry beloved across the Balkans, filled with spiced meat, cheese, or spinach—perfect as a snack or light meal. To end your culinary tour on a sweet note, treat yourself to Dubrovnik’s handmade gelato, made with fresh fruit, nuts, and chocolate. It’s the perfect indulgence for a stroll along the Stradun or a sunset pause by the harbor. Each dish offers a taste of Dubrovnik’s history, culture, and vibrant Mediterranean spirit.
